Graphic Design I |
|
Graphic Design I covers desktop publishing and design/color basics. Microsoft Publisher 2007 is used extensively and students will learn all the features that this program has to offer. Students will also cover basic design principles. Students will reproduce assigned projects as well as construct and design their own creative works. Upon completion of this course, the student will be able to: · Demonstrate the ability to save and retrieve files, create directories and manage the computer desktop. · Demonstrate a working knowledge of Microsoft Publisher tools and menus. · Use computer hardware and Microsoft Publisher software to design documents including newsletters, brochures, business sets, resumes, tables, graphs and other publishing materials. · Learn the basic rules of graphic design and demonstrate their use using the Microsoft drawing program by producing and designing materials and printing them.
